Born in Russia into a family of musicians, Arseniy Shkaptsov moved to Ticino in 2011 to complete his studies. He graduated as a bassoonist from the Conservatorio della Svizzera Italiana (CSI) and as an orchestra conductor from the Zurich University of the Arts. Arseniy quickly made a name for himself, winning numerous music competitions and conducting prestigious orchestras, leading him to collaborate with internationally renowned musicians. Fresh out of school, in 2017 at just 28 years old, he founded the United Soloists Orchestra: a symphony orchestra of about sixty musicians of various nationalities, aimed at promoting these young talents as soloists and highlighting their diverse cultural traditions through music.

The Majid Foundation embraced Arseniy Shkaptsov’s dream, financially supporting him in launching the United Soloists Orchestra’s concert season, including a performance held at Collegio Papio in Ascona on October 9, 2021.
